Distinctive Models Within the Series

The Kawasaki Ninja ZX Series features several distinctive models, each designed to meet specific rider preferences and performance demands. The Ninja ZX-6R, for example, is renowned for its 636cc engine, offering a balanced combination of agility and power suitable for both street riding and amateur racing. Its lightweight frame and advanced aerodynamics contribute to exceptional handling.

The Ninja ZX-10R is a flagship sportbike within the series, equipped with a 998cc engine. It is engineered for high-speed stability and precise control, making it a favorite among professional racers. Its sophisticated electronics and aerodynamic design emphasize performance and rider confidence.

The Ninja ZX-4R, a newer addition, provides a smaller displacement option at 400cc, targeting riders seeking a more approachable yet exhilarating experience. It combines modern styling with performance features found in larger models, making it an appealing choice for new enthusiasts and city riders alike.

Each of these models exemplifies Kawasaki’s dedication to innovation and versatility within the Ninja ZX Series, catering to diverse riding styles and skill levels while maintaining the series’ reputation for reliability and performance.

Performance Comparison Across Models

The performance of the Kawasaki Ninja ZX Series varies significantly across its different models, reflecting their designated riding purposes and technological advancements. The series includes models such as the Ninja ZX-6R, ZX-10R, and ZX-4R, each optimized for specific performance characteristics.

Key aspects used to compare these models include engine capacity, power output, and handling. For example:

  • The Ninja ZX-10R boasts a 998cc engine delivering over 200 horsepower, making it ideal for high-speed riding and racing.
  • The Ninja ZX-6R features a 636cc engine, offering a balanced mix of agility and speed suitable for both street riding and track use.
  • The newer Ninja ZX-4R, with its smaller 400cc engine, emphasizes versatility, fuel efficiency, and beginner-friendliness.

ABS and Traction Control Systems

The Kawasaki Ninja ZX Series incorporates advanced safety features such as Anti-lock Braking System (ABS) and traction control systems to enhance rider safety. These technologies help prevent wheel lock-up during hard braking and maintain optimal grip during acceleration, respectively.

ABS is designed to automatically modulate brake pressure, allowing the rider to maintain steering control under emergency braking conditions. This feature is particularly valuable at high speeds, helping reduce stopping distances and minimizing the risk of crashes.

Traction control systems work by monitoring wheel slip and adjusting power delivery to ensure maximum traction. In the Kawasaki Ninja ZX Series, these systems are electronically operated, allowing riders to customize their experience through multiple riding modes. This is especially beneficial in varying conditions such as wet or uneven surfaces.

Overall, the inclusion of ABS and traction control in the Kawasaki Ninja ZX Series demonstrates the manufacturer’s commitment to rider safety and technological innovation. Both systems contribute significantly to a safer riding experience across different models.

Riding Modes and Electronics

Modern Kawasaki Ninja ZX Series motorcycles are equipped with advanced riding modes and electronic systems that enhance rider control and safety. These features are integral to delivering a dynamic riding experience tailored to various conditions.

Riding modes allow riders to select different electronic settings that adjust throttle response, power delivery, and traction control. Typically, options include modes like "Sport," "Road," and "Rain," each optimizing motorcycle performance for specific scenarios and rider preferences.

Electronic systems such as ABS (Anti-lock Braking System) and traction control are standard in many models within the Kawasaki Ninja ZX Series. These systems help prevent wheel lock-up during braking and maintain optimal traction, especially on slippery surfaces, thus improving overall safety.

Furthermore, advanced electronics may include riding mode selectors that seamlessly adapt engine maps and electronic assists, providing a customizable riding experience. These features exemplify Kawasaki’s commitment to safety and performance, making the Ninja ZX Series suitable for both aggressive riding and everyday commuting.
